Saute, a cooking method that involves quickly frying food in a shallow pan over high heat with a small amount of oil, is a game-changer in the kitchen. This technique helps seal in the juices and create a delicious caramelized exterior on your ingredients.
Whether you’re sauteing vegetables to retain their crisp texture or searing meat for a mouthwatering crust, mastering the art of sauteing can bring your culinary creations to the next level. In conclusion, sautéing is a versatile cooking technique that involves quickly frying food in a small amount of oil or fat over high heat. Sautéed dishes can range from vegetables to meats, and even include a variety of seasonings and flavors for a delicious outcome. By mastering the art of sautéing, home cooks can create flavorful and nutrient-rich meals in a short amount of time.
Whether you are using a sauté pan or a skillet, the key to successful sautéing lies in properly heating the pan, ensuring even cooking, and flipping or stirring the ingredients as needed.
